在windows下安装Hadoop时遇到如下问题:
1.windows下启动hadoop提示(hadoop version)
JAVA_HOME is incorrectly set.
原因:目录的dos文件名模式下的缩写,长于8个字符的文件名和文件夹名,都被简化成前面6个有效字符,后面~1,有重名的就 ~2,~3,
解决方法:在java_home的路径里用PROGRA~1 代替 C:\Program Files
例:java_home=C:\PROGRA~1\Java\jdk1.8.0_121
2.windos的 cmd命令里面的call必须定格写。
解决方法:将Hadoop安装目录下的bin目录下的所有的*.cmd文件中的call语句前边的 空格删掉。
网友评论